Prelinger Archives. A 50-50 Chance / Prelinger Archives.
This Government safety film is about tetanus infection. In this dramatization, a wife/mother becomes sick with tetanus and has to be hospitalized because she was never vaccinated against it. Viewers learn how tetanus is contracted and how it can be prevented.
